Learning System

English Education was mainly focused on the following study skills at IBU English Preparatory School in Skopje.
 
Reading - extensive / intensive, scanning, skimming, using context clues and vocabulary strategies, recognizing sequence, fact vs. opinion, making inferences, identifying main ideas and supporting details, analyzing text, identifying purpose and tone.

Listening - listening for gist and details, learning topic vocabulary to improve comprehension, for verbal clues, understanding speaker’s argument, understanding colloquial language, learning pronunciation, to summarize opinions, recognize lecture language that introduces the topic or the plan, that signals new ideas, transitions, definitions, examples, explanations, causes and effects, comparisons and contrasts, opinions, citations and quotations, non-verbal signals, note-taking.

Writing -how to write a paragraph, topic sentences, supporting details, concluding sentences; the writing process: prewriting, writing editing; organizing information by: time, importance, space; essay writing: introduction, body conclusion; types of essays: process, division and classification, causes and effects, comparison and contrast, problem/solution, summaries, opinion essay, essays for undergraduate and graduate school applications, personal and business letters; punctuations.

Speaking - descriptions, retelling a story, practical English: in a shop, hotel, at the doctors etc. debates, interviews, giving a talk, discussions: show interest, enter a discussion, interrupt, ask for more information, agree and disagree, support opinion, connect your ideas with other people’s ideas, contribute your ideas, keep the discussion focused on the topic, encourage others to participate, bring to a consensus, learn to compromise, pausing, paraphrasing and quoting.

Grammar - from elementary to upper-intermediate (everything that these levels include by the standards of CEFR)

Vocabulary - personal information, food, health and medicine, houses and decoration, personality and appearance adjectives, family, body, money and economics, science and technology, education, shopping and traveling, entertainment, music, humor, history and politics, man and women, animals and conservation, crime and punishment, business, word-building, and all relevant specific fields connected to the academic vocabulary.

Study skills- Preparing to study, note-taking, strategies for reading textbooks/novels, using reference sources, oral presentations, projects, managing time, setting goals, preparing oral presentations, managing and participating in group projects, consciousness-raising/self awareness,setting self-assessment criteria, developing autonomous learning and language use.
